Generic Name: Vitamin D
Vitamin D is found in numerous dietary sources such as fish, eggs, fortified milk, and cod liver oil. The sun is also a significant contributor to the body's daily production of vitamin D. Cholecalciferol is the most widely known of the vitamin D series and is a fat soluble vitamin.
